Choosing the Right Black Trim Restorer for Your Car

Longevity & Durability

The biggest frustration with trim restorers is how quickly they fade or wash away. Look for products formulated with advanced polymers like graphene or acrylic (as seen in Turtle Wax Graphene Black Trim Restorer) instead of basic silicones. These bond more strongly to the plastic, resisting car washes, rain, and UV exposure. While silicone-based options (like some found in Mothers Back-to-Black) are cheaper, they require significantly more frequent reapplication. Consider how often you’re willing to reapply – a longer-lasting product saves you time and money in the long run.

Finish: Gloss vs. Matte

Decide whether you prefer a glossy or matte finish. Many restorers aim for a deep, rich black, but the level of sheen varies. Solution Finish Black Trim Restorer specifically highlights its matte finish, which is ideal if you dislike a shiny look. Others might offer a slight gloss. Consider your car’s overall aesthetic and whether a glossy trim will complement or clash with the existing paint and features.

UV Protection

Black plastic trim is particularly vulnerable to fading and cracking from sun exposure. A good trim restorer must contain UV protectants. This is a standard feature in most products, but the strength of the protection varies. Products explicitly mentioning UV defense (like Turtle Wax Graphene) are a good choice if your car spends a lot of time outdoors. Without adequate UV protection, your trim will quickly revert to its faded state, regardless of how well the restorer initially worked.

Ease of Application

Most trim restorers are designed for easy DIY application. However, consider the application method and drying time. Some require a foam applicator and buffing (Turtle Wax Graphene), while others can be applied with a microfiber towel (Mothers Back-to-Black). Look for a non-greasy formula that dries quickly to avoid residue – this is a key benefit of graphene-based products.

Other Features to Consider: * Compatibility: Most restorers work on various plastic, vinyl, and rubber trims. * Cleaning Ability: Some products (Mothers Back-to-Black) also remove light oxidation and dirt. * Cost: Price varies significantly; budget-friendly options are available, but may lack the longevity of premium products. * Versatility: Can be used on bumpers, grilles, mirror housings, window trim, and more.
